  • Abstract
    The facilitated transfer of alkaline-earth metal ions across the nitrobenzene|water interface due to the complexation with polyoxyethylene(40)isooctylphenyl ether (Triton X-405) causes abnormally large ion transfer currents across the interface. This reproducible anomaly due to the convective transport of the Triton X-405-ion complex formed in the vicinity of the interface is an example of the electrochemical instability, which was recently proposed for the transfer of surface active ions across the liquid|liquid interface, in the case of interfacial complexation. Well-known interfacial turbulences in the process of solvent extraction may be interpreted in terms of the electrochemical instability.
